无论是进行日常维护、系统升级,还是应对紧急情况,了解并掌握远程服务器的关机方法至关重要
本文将详细介绍多种远程关机的方法,并探讨其适用场景和注意事项,以帮助运维人员高效、安全地完成这一任务
一、Windows系统的远程关机方法 对于Windows操作系统的服务器,远程关机可以通过以下几种方式实现: 1.使用远程桌面协议(RDP) 如果服务器已经启用了远程桌面功能,你可以使用远程桌面连接工具(如Windows远程桌面)连接到服务器
在远程桌面环境中,操作与本地计算机无异,只需点击“开始”菜单,然后选择“关机”或“重新启动”选项即可
2.使用命令行工具 在Windows服务器上,你可以使用“shutdown”命令来实现关机操作
通过命令提示符(CMD)或PowerShell窗口,输入以下命令: - 关机:`shutdown /s` - 重启:`shutdown /r` 你还可以指定关机或重启的时间,以及向用户发送的消息
例如,`shutdown /s /t 30 /c 服务器即将关机`表示在30秒后关机,并显示“服务器即将关机”的消息
3.使用远程管理工具 微软提供了多种远程管理工具,如Windows Admin Center和Remote Server Administration Tools,这些工具允许你对服务器进行远程管理,包括关机和重启操作
通过这些工具,你可以方便地访问服务器的管理界面,并执行相应的关机命令
4.使用IPMI工具 许多服务器厂商提供了IPMI(Intelligent Platform Management Interface)工具,它允许你在服务器关闭或运行时执行管理操作
通过IPMI工具登录服务器的管理界面,你可以选择关机或重启选项
二、Linux系统的远程关机方法 对于Linux操作系统的服务器,远程关机通常通过SSH(Secure Shell)等远程终端工具来实现
以下是一些常用的方法: 1.使用SSH工具 通过SSH工具(如PuTTY、SecureCRT等)连接到Linux服务器,然后在终端中输入关机命令
常用的关机命令包括: - 关机:`sudo shutdown -hnow` - 重启:`sudo shutdown -rnow` 这些命令会立即执行关机或重启操作
如果你希望延迟关机或重启,可以使用`+n`参数来指定延迟时间(以分钟为单位)
例如,`shutdown -h +15`表示在15分钟后关机
2.使用reboot命令 另一种在Linux系统中进行远程关机和重启的方法是使用`reboot`命令
这个命令会立即重启服务器
需要注意的是,使用`reboot`命令时,系统不会进行正常的关机流程,因此可能会丢失未保存的数据
3.使用远程管理工具 与Windows系统类似,Linux系统也可以使用远程管理工具(如VNC、TeamViewer等)来实现远程关机
这些工具提供了图形化的用户界面,使得操作更加直观和方便
三、其他远程关机方法 除了上述针对特定操作系统的远程关机方法外,还有一些通用的远程关机方法,这些方法适用于不同类型的服务器和操作系统
1.使用远程控制软件 远程控制软件(如向日葵、AnyDesk等)允许你从远程位置控制服务器
这些软件通常提供了关机和重启的选项,使得操作更加便捷
在使用这些软件时,需要确保被控制端计算机上已经安装了相应的客户端软件,并且已经正确配置了网络连接
2.使用远程管理卡 一些服务器设备配备了远程管理卡(如iDRAC、iLO、BMC等),这些卡提供了远程管理服务器的功能,包括关机和重启操作
通过远程管理卡提供的界面,你可以方便地访问服务器的管理功能,并执行相应的关机命令
3.使用远程电源管理功能 对于支持远程电源管理的服务器(如采用了IPMI或iLO等功能的服务器),你可以通过访问服务器的管理界面,通过相应的选项进行关机或重启操作
这种方法通常需要在服务器硬件层面进行配置和启用
四、注意事项与最佳实践 在进行远程关机操作时,需要注意以下几点: 1.确保权限和合理性 在执行关机或重启操作之前,务必确保你有足够的权限和合理的理由来执行这些操作
误操作可能会导致不必要的数据丢失或业务中断
2.通知相关人员 在关机或重启之前,应该通知相关人员,以确保他们了解即将发生的操作,并有机会保存工作和数据
3.保存工作和数据 在关机或重启之前,确保所有重要的工作和数据都已经保存
这包括正在运行的进程、打开的文档和未发送的邮件等
4.选择合适的时机 避免在业务高峰期或关键时间段进行关机或重启操作
这些操作可能会导致服务中断或性能下降,从而对业务造成不利影响
5.记录操作日志 对于重要的关机或重启操作,应该记录操作日志
这有助于追踪操作的历史记录,并在出现问题时进行故障排查
6.使用安全的远程连接方式 在进行远程关机操作时,应该使用安全的远程连接方式(如SSH、RDP等),并确保网络连接的安全性
避免使用不安全的连接方式(如Telnet等),以防止数据泄露和攻击风险
五、结论 远程服务器的关机操作是IT运维管理中的重要环节
通过了解并掌握多种远程关机方法,运维人员可以更加高效、安全地完成这一任务
无论是使用操作系统自带的命令、远程管理工具、服务器管理接口还是远程电源控制器等方法,都需要确保操作的正确性和安全性
同时,遵循最佳实践和建议也可以提高操作的效率和可靠性
在未来的IT运维工作中,随着技术的不断进步和发展,我们期待更多创新、高效的远程关机方法出现,以更好地满足运维管理的需求